Men's full brogue Oxford dress shoes The brogue (derived from the Gaelic bróg (Irish), bròg (Scottish) "shoe")[1][2] is a style of low-heeled shoe or boot traditionally characterised by multiple-piece, sturdy leather uppers with decorative perforations (or "broguing") and serration along the pieces' visible edges. 8 Most Terrifying Airport Runways
1. Saint Maarten in the Caribbean – Princess Juliana International Airport This is one of the busiest airports in the Caribbean. Due to the short runway length (7,150 feet), planes on their final approach need to fly over the beach at minimal altitude, and over a part of the fence and the road.
